Mechanism of Action

Upon injection, the crosslinked HA gel in Anchora delivers instant volume and lift to the targeted areas, effectively smoothing wrinkles and restoring facial contours. Simultaneously, the hydroxyapatite microspheres act as a scaffold, stimulating fibroblasts to produce new collagen and elastin fibers. This dual-action approach not only enhances immediate aesthetic outcomes but also promotes long-term improvements in skin elasticity and firmness. Over time, as the HA gel is naturally metabolized, the newly formed collagen network maintains the structural support, resulting in enduring rejuvenation.​
